Just saw this on autoblog. The 2009 Mini First, unfortunately only available in the U.K. right now. It has a 1.4L, 75hp, 4cyl, with 6-speed manual and gets...53.3MPG

Be aware that gallons are about the only things that are smaller in Merka than in Yurp - a British (or 'Imperial', natch) gallon is 20% bigger than a US gallon, so that 53.3mpg becomes 44.4mpg from a US gallon.
So the diesel Cooper's British combined fuel economy of 72.4mpg is 'only' 60.3mpg in US gallons.
Mind you, Yurpeen driving is much more stop/start and acceleration-intensive than Merkan driving, so you would expect to get most of that 20% loss back again in US conditions.
